Avani wrote the linear equation Y=5X+4. Then, she wrote the equation of the line that is perpendicular to Y=5X+4 and that passes through (15,–2). If her new equation is in the form Y=-1/5X+B, what is the value of b?

The equation of the line perpendicular to Y = 5X + 4 is given by:
Y = -1 / 5X + B.
We observe that this line passes through the point (15, -2).
We have then:
-2 = -1 / 5 (15) + B.
Clearing B we have:
-2 = -3 + B.
-2 + 3 = B
B = 1
Answer:
the value of B is:
B = 1
